Bio:
Loren Allred is best known for her jaw-dropping vocal performance of the RIAA multi-platinum song “Never Enough” from the Oscar-nominated and Grammy award-winning “The Greatest Showman” soundtrack and film. Being the voice in the movie and not the actress, Loren was mostly an industry secret until April 2022 when she appeared on Britain's Got Talent performing “Never Enough.” The story of finally connecting her face to the song launched her into the semi-finals and finals of the competition. Loren’s three performances earned rave reviews from judges Amanda Holden (“Astonishing”), Simon Cowell ("Iconic"), Alisha Dixon (“Transcendent”), and David Williams (“Superstar”). She performed her new single “Last Thing I’ll Ever Need,” making her television debut as a songwriter.
Before her recent emergence Loren dueted with Michael Bublé' on his 2019 Love album for the classic “Help Me Make It Through the Night.” She appeared alongside chart-topping songwriter, producer, and maestro to the stars David Foster as part of his An Intimate Evening PBS Concert Special and album in November 2019.
In 2021 and 2022, Loren began to release original music via her EP “Late Bloomer.” Singles “Til I Found You” and “This Summer” received positive reviews; Loren also toured her new music and appeared on tours with Andrea Bocelli and David Foster through 2022. Her second EP, 'I Hear Your Voice,' was released on April 6th, 2023.
